Mobile Country Code
The ITU-T Recommendation E.212 defines mobile country codes (MCC) as well as mobile network codes (MNC). Overview The mobile country code consists of three decimal digits and the mobile network code consists of two or three decimal digits (for example: MNC of 001 is not the same as MNC of 01). The first digit of the mobile country code identifies the geographic region as follows (the digits 1 and 8 are not used): * 0: Test networks * 2: Europe * 3: North America and the Caribbean * 4: Asia and the Middle East * 5: Australia and Oceania * 6: Africa * 7: South and Central America * 9: Worldwide (Satellite, Air—aboard aircraft, Maritime—aboard ships, Antarctica) An MCC is used in combination with an MNC (a combination known as an "MCC/MNC tuple") to uniquely identify a mobile network operator (carrier) using the GSM (including GSM-R), UMTS, LTE, and 5G public land mobile networks. Airtel India
Airtel India is the second largest provider of mobile telephony and third largest provider of fixed telephony in India, and is also a provider of broadband and subscription television services. The brand is operated by several subsidiaries of Bharti Airtel, with Bharti Hexacom and Bharti Telemedia providing broadband fixed line services and Bharti Infratel providing telecom passive infrastructure service such as telecom equipment and telecom towers. Currently, Airtel provides 2G, 4G, 4G+, VoLTE and VoWiFi services all over India and 5G service in selected cities. Currently offered services include fixed-line broadband, and voice services depending upon the country of operation. Airtel had also rolled out its VoLTE technology across all Indian telecom circles. Bharti Airtel Limited is part of Bharti Enterprises and is headed by Sunil Bharti Mittal. Airtel is the first Indian telecom service provider to achieve Cisco Gold Certification. Jio Platforms
Jio Platforms is an Indian multinational technology company, headquartered in Mumbai. It is a subsidiary of Reliance Industries. Established in 2019, it acts as a holding company for India's largest mobile network operator Jio and other digital businesses of Reliance. Since April 2020, Reliance Industries has raised by selling 32.97% equity stake in the company. In August 2021, it was ranked 155th on the 2021 Fortune Global 500 list of world's biggest corporations. History In October 2019, Reliance Industries Limited (RIL) announced the creation of a wholly owned subsidiary for its digital businesses including Jio. In November 2019, the subsidiary was named Jio Platforms. The liability of Jio was transferred to RIL and in turn RIL received preferential shares of Jio Platforms. Singtel
Singapore Telecommunications Limited, commonly known as Singtel, is a Singaporean telecommunications conglomerate and one of the four major telcos operating in the country. The company is the largest mobile network operator in Singapore with 4.1 million subscribers and through subsidiaries, has a combined mobile subscriber base of 640 million customers at the end of financial year 2017. The company was known as Telecommunications Equipment until 1995. Singtel provides ISP, IPTV (Singtel TV) and mobile phone networks and fixed line telephony services. Singtel has expanded aggressively outside its home market and owns shares in many regional operators, including full ownership of Australia's second largest telco Optus and 32.15% of Bharti Airtel, the second largest carrier in India. Bharti Enterprises
Bharti Enterprises is an Indian multinational conglomerate, headquartered in Delhi. It was founded in 1976 by Sunil Mittal. Bharti Enterprises owns businesses spanning across manufacturing, telecommunications, agribusiness, real estate, hospitality, agri and food. The group's flagship company, Bharti Airtel, is a telecom service provider with operations in more than 18 countries across Asia, North America, Africa & Europe. The company ranks amongst the top two mobile network operators globally in terms of subscribers. History The company was founded by Sunil Bharti Mittal with his two siblings in 1976. The company initially started manufacturing bicycles before diversifying into other sectors. It entered into telecommunications industry in 1995. Companies Bharti is present in many sectors with the largest revenue contribution coming from the telecom industry. LTE Advanced
LTE Advanced (LTE+) is a mobile communication standard and a major enhancement of the LTE (telecommunication), Long Term Evolution (LTE) standard. It was formally submitted as a candidate 4G to ITU-T in late 2009 as meeting the requirements of the IMT-Advanced standard, and was standardized by the 3rd Generation Partnership Project (3GPP) in March 2011 as 3GPP Release 10. The LTE+ format was first proposed by NTT DoCoMo of Japan and has been adopted as the international standard. LTE standardization has matured to a state where changes in the specification are limited to corrections and bug fixes. The first commercial services were launched in Sweden and Norway in December 2009 followed by the United States and Japan in 2010. 3GPP Long Term Evolution
In telecommunications, long-term evolution (LTE) is a standard for wireless broadband communication for mobile devices and data terminals, based on the GSM/EDGE and UMTS/HSPA standards. It improves on those standards' capacity and speed by using a different radio interface and core network improvements. LTE is the upgrade path for carriers with both GSM/UMTS networks and CDMA2000 networks. Because LTE frequencies and bands differ from country to country, only multi-band phones can use LTE in all countries where it is supported. The standard is developed by the 3GPP (3rd Generation Partnership Project) and is specified in its Release 8 document series, with minor enhancements described in Release 9. LTE is also called 3.95G and has been marketed as "4G LTE" and "Advanced 4G"; but it does not meet the technical criteria of a 4G wireless service, as specified in the 3GPP Release 8 and 9 document series for LTE Advanced. HSPA+
Evolved High Speed Packet Access, HSPA+, HSPA (Plus) or HSPAP, is a technical standard for wireless broadband telecommunication. It is the second phase of HSPA which has been introduced in 3GPP release 7 and being further improved in later 3GPP releases. HSPA+ can achieve data rates of up to 42.2 Mbit/s. It introduces antenna array technologies such as beamforming and multiple-input multiple-output communications (MIMO). Beam forming focuses the transmitted power of an antenna in a beam towards the user's direction. MIMO uses multiple antennas at the sending and receiving side. Further releases of the standard have introduced dual carrier operation, i.e. the simultaneous use of two 5 MHz carriers. HSPA+ is an evolution of HSPA that upgrades the existing 3G network and provides a method for telecom operators to migrate towards 4G speeds that are more comparable to the initially available speeds of newer LTE networks without deploying a new radio interface. UMTS
The Universal Mobile Telecommunications System (UMTS) is a third generation mobile cellular system for networks based on the GSM standard. Developed and maintained by the 3GPP (3rd Generation Partnership Project), UMTS is a component of the International Telecommunication Union IMT-2000 standard set and compares with the CDMA2000 standard set for networks based on the competing cdmaOne technology. UMTS uses wideband code-division multiple access (W-CDMA) radio access technology to offer greater spectral efficiency and bandwidth to mobile network operators. UMTS specifies a complete network system, which includes the radio access network (UMTS Terrestrial Radio Access Network, or UTRAN), the core network (Mobile Application Part, or MAP) and the authentication of users via SIM (subscriber identity module) cards. High Speed Packet Access
High Speed Packet Access (HSPA) is an amalgamation of two mobile protocols—High Speed Downlink Packet Access (HSDPA) and High Speed Uplink Packet Access (HSUPA)—that extends and improves the performance of existing 3G mobile telecommunication networks using the WCDMA protocols. A further-improved 3GPP standard called Evolved High Speed Packet Access (also known as HSPA+) was released late in 2008, with subsequent worldwide adoption beginning in 2010. The newer standard allows bit rates to reach as high as 337 Mbit/s in the downlink and 34 Mbit/s in the uplink; however, these speeds are rarely achieved in practice. Overview The first HSPA specifications supported increased peak data rates of up to 14 Mbit/s in the downlink and 5.76 Mbit/s in the uplink. They also reduced latency and provided up to five times more system capacity in the downlink and up to twice as much system capacity in the uplink compared with original WCDMA protocol. Airtel Uganda
Airtel Uganda Limited is a mobile communications and information technology services provider in Uganda. The company also offers mobile funds transfer and banking services known as ''Airtel Payments Bank''. Airtel Uganda Limited is a subsidiary of Airtel Africa PLC. Location The headquarters of Airtel Uganda are located in ''Airtel Towers'', along Clement Hill Road, in the Central Division of Kampala, the county's capital and largest city. The coordinates of the headquarters are 0°19'14.0"N, 32°35'18.0"E (Latitude:0.320556; Longitude:32.588333). History Airtel entered the Uganda Market on June 8, 2010 when Bharti Airtel acquired 16 Zain Africa operations. In 2013, Airtel fully acquired Warid Telecom Uganda in the first ever in-country acquisition in the telecommunications sector.
